C# BitmapButton组件DEMO快速体验指南

版权申诉
0 下载量 54 浏览量 更新于2024-10-12 收藏 10KB ZIP 举报
资源摘要信息:"本资源为一个C#组件的示例程序(DEMO),包含了BitmapButton的实现及使用。通过下载并查看该示例,用户能够快速学习并掌握如何在C#中实现自定义的BitmapButton组件。该示例程序使用方便,能够让用户快速接入和测试。" 知识点详细说明: 1. C# 组件开发: C# 组件开发是指利用C#编程语言创建可以重用的代码单元,这些单元通常封装特定的功能或逻辑,可以被其他应用程序调用。在本资源中,BitmapButton组件是一个具体例子,它是一个具有特定功能的控件,可以集成到其他C#应用程序中,用于实现按钮功能,同时可以显示一个位图图像。 2. 自定义控件: 自定义控件是开发中常用的技术,它允许开发者根据特定的需求设计和实现具有独特外观和行为的用户界面元素。在本资源中,BitmapButton是一个自定义控件,开发者需要编写相应的C#代码来实现其功能。 3. 位图按钮(BitmapButton): 位图按钮是指在其表面显示图片的按钮控件。用户可以通过点击该按钮触发相应的事件处理逻辑。位图按钮常见于需要提供视觉反馈的用户界面,如工具栏或对话框中。 4. DEMO程序的作用: DEMO程序是为了演示如何使用特定技术或产品而设计的简化版应用程序。它可以快速地向用户展示某个功能或组件是如何工作的,通常用于教学或产品演示目的。在本资源中,Demo程序展示了一个简单的BitmapButton组件使用示例。 5. 文件名称列表解析: - Form1.cs: 这是一个C#代码文件,通常包含一个Windows窗体应用程序的主窗体代码。在本资源中,Form1.cs可能包含了展示BitmapButton组件使用界面的实现。 - BitmapButton.cs: 这个文件应该包含了自定义的BitmapButton组件的C#代码实现,包括其属性、方法和事件的定义。 - AssemblyInfo.cs: 包含程序集信息的文件,通常用于定义程序集的属性,如版本号、描述、公司名等。 - BitmapButton.csproj: C#项目文件,用于定义项目结构、依赖项以及构建配置等信息。 - App.ico: 应用程序图标文件,用于给程序设置一个图标。 - Form1.resx: 这是资源文件,用于存储Form1的本地化字符串和其他资源。 - BitmapButton.sln: 解决方案文件,表示解决方案级别,包含一个或多个项目。 - BitmapButton.suo: 解决方案用户选项文件,包含了与解决方案相关的特定于用户的信息。 ***.txt: 可能是一个文本文件,用于提供某种说明或信息,但具体内容需要查看文件内容才能确定。 - BitmapButton.csproj.user: 包含了与BitmapButton.csproj相关的用户特定设置。 在进行C#组件开发时,开发者需要熟悉.NET框架的类库,了解如何创建用户控件和窗体应用程序。此外,掌握XML基础知识对于理解和修改项目文件(如.csproj和.sln)也是非常重要的。通过本资源的实践,开发者可以加深对C#组件开发流程的理解,并能够实际创建和部署自定义的BitmapButton控件。